1. Creamy Green Smoothie Bowl

Are you craving a refreshing breakfast that’s both nutritious and delicious? This creamy green smoothie bowl is a delightful way to kickstart your morning with the goodness of leafy greens and ripe bananas. With its vibrant color from fresh spinach and avocado, this bowl not only looks great but is also packed with essential vitamins and minerals.Top it off with your choice of sliced fruits, chia seeds, or granola for a delightful crunch. It’s an easy way to sneak in some greens while savoring a tasty treat!
Ingredients:
– 2 cups spinach
– 1 ripe banana
– 1/2 avocado
– 1 cup almond milk (or any plant-based milk)
– Toppings: sliced fruits, chia seeds, granola
Instructions:
1. In a blender, combine spinach, banana, avocado, and almond milk.
2. Blend until the mixture is smooth and creamy.
3. Pour the smoothie into bowls and add your favorite toppings.
4. Enjoy immediately for the best flavor!
– You can use frozen banana for a creamier texture.
– Feel free to substitute other greens like kale or Swiss chard!

3. Peanut Butter Banana Overnight Oats

Looking for a quick breakfast that you can prepare in advance? These peanut butter banana overnight oats are a dream come true! Simply make them the night before, and you’ll wake up to a creamy, indulgent meal ready to enjoy.Packed with rolled oats, almond milk, peanut butter, and sliced banana, this dish is rich in healthy fats and fiber to keep you full until lunchtime. Add flax seeds or chocolate chips for a delicious twist!
Ingredients:
– 1/2 cup rolled oats
– 1 cup almond milk (or any plant-based milk)
– 2 tablespoons peanut butter
– 1 banana, sliced
– 1 tablespoon chia seeds (optional)
Instructions:
1. In a jar, mix rolled oats, almond milk, peanut butter, and chia seeds.
2. Stir well and top with sliced banana.
3. Cover and refrigerate overnight.
4. In the morning, stir and enjoy!
– Drizzle with maple syrup in the morning for added sweetness.
– Try different nut butters for a fun variety!

4. Berry Chia Pudding

Craving something nutritious yet indulgent? This berry chia pudding is a delightful breakfast option that’s as beautiful as it is delicious! Perfect for a quick grab-and-go meal, it’s loaded with antioxidants and omega-3 fatty acids to give your morning a boost.Watch as chia seeds absorb liquid and transform into a creamy pudding-like consistency. Layer it with your favorite berries and a sprinkle of nuts or seeds for a breakfast that feels like dessert!
Ingredients:
– 1/4 cup chia seeds
– 1 cup almond milk (or any plant-based milk)
– 1 tablespoon maple syrup (optional)
– 1 cup mixed berries (strawberries, blueberries, raspberries)
Instructions:
1. In a bowl, mix chia seeds, almond milk, and maple syrup.
2. Stir well and let it sit for about 5 minutes, then stir again.
3.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ours or overnight.
4. Serve in bowls or jars and top with mixed berries.
– Add vanilla extract for an extra flavor boost.
– Experiment with different fruits for more variety!

How To Choose Gluten-Free Vegan Breakfast Recipes
Choosing the right gluten-free vegan breakfast recipes can be both fun and overwhelming. With so many options available, it’s essential to focus on a few key points to help you select meals that fit your dietary needs and taste preferences. Here are some important criteria to consider:
1. Nutritional Value
When looking for gluten-free vegan breakfast recipes, prioritize those with high nutritional value. Aim for meals packed with whole grains, fruits, and vegetables. Ingredients like quinoa, oats, and chia seeds offer protein and fiber, while fruits add vitamins and antioxidants. Check recipes to ensure they include a variety of nutrients that will keep you energized throughout the morning.
2. Flavor Combinations
Flavor is key to enjoying your breakfast. Look for recipes that incorporate a mix of sweet and savory elements. For example, a creamy green smoothie can be enhanced with a bit of ginger or a savory tofu scramble can include spices like turmeric and garlic. Experiment with different combinations to find flavors you love.
3. Preparation Time
Consider how much time you have in the morning. Some gluten-free vegan breakfast recipes can be prepped ahead, like overnight oats or chia pudding, which save time during busy mornings. Others may take longer, like pancakes or breakfast burritos, which are perfect for weekends. Knowing your schedule helps you choose the right recipes.
4. Ingredient Availability
Make sure the ingredients in your chosen recipes are easy to find. It can be frustrating to commit to a recipe only to discover you can’t source a crucial ingredient. Stick to recipes that use common foods available at your local grocery store. This will make meal prep easier and more enjoyable.
5. Dietary Preferences
Take into account any additional dietary needs or preferences. If you are watching your sugar intake, look for recipes that use natural sweeteners like bananas or dates instead of refined sugars. Similarly, if you prefer low-carb options, find recipes featuring vegetables, like a sweet potato hash or a quinoa breakfast bowl. Personalizing your choices will help you stick to your healthy eating goals.
6. Meal Variety
Variety keeps breakfast interesting and enjoyable. Choose recipes that offer different textures and flavors – from smoothies to hearty breakfast bowls. This variety not only makes your meals more exciting but also ensures you get a wide range of nutrients. Aim to rotate your recipes weekly to keep your breakfast routine fresh.

7. Sweet Potato Hash

Looking for a hearty breakfast that’s gluten-free and vegan? This sweet potato hash is a fantastic choice! Packed with vibrant veggies and spices, it’s a wholesome way to start your morning.Simply sauté diced sweet potatoes with bell peppers, onions, and spices until everything is golden and tender. Top with slices of avocado for a creamy finish. This dish is filling and a great way to sneak in extra vegetables!
Ingredients:
– 2 sweet potatoes, diced
– 1 bell pepper, chopped
– 1/2 onion, chopped
– 1 avocado, sliced
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– Spices: cumin, paprika, salt
Instructions:
1. In a sk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at.
2. Add sweet potatoes and cook for about 10 minutes.
3. Add bell pepper, onion, and spices, cooking until everything is tender.
4. Serve hot with avocado slices on top.
– Add greens like spinach for extra nutrients.
– This dish is great for meal prep—reheat leftovers throughout the week!

9. Oatmeal Banana Pancakes

Fluffy pancakes made with oats and bananas? Yes, please! These gluten-free vegan pancakes are not only simple to whip up but also provide a delicious start to your morning.Blending oats into a flour-like consistency adds unique texture and flavor, while bananas lend natural sweetness. Top them with fresh fruits, maple syrup, or nut butter for a delightful breakfast experience!
Ingredients:
– 1 cup rolled oats
– 1 ripe banana
– 1 cup almond milk (or any plant-based milk)
– 1 teaspoon baking powder
– 1 tablespoon maple syrup (optional)
Instructions:
1. Blend oats into a flour consistency.
2. In a bowl, mix oat flour with banana, almond milk, baking powder, and maple syrup.
3. Heat a skillet and pour batter to form pancakes.
4. Cook until bubbles form, then flip to cook the other side.
5. Serve warm with toppings of choice.
– For fluffier pancakes, let the batter sit for a few minutes before cooking.
– Add cinnamon to the batter for an extra flavor boost!
10. Savory Tofu Scramble

If you love a savory breakfast, this tofu scramble is a fantastic alternative to traditional scrambled eggs! It’s loaded with protein and veggies, making it a hearty meal perfect for any time of the day.Crumbled tofu is sautéed with spices, onions, and bell peppers, creating a delicious dish that pairs well with toast or wraps for a filling breakfast!
Ingredients:
– 1 block firm tofu, crumbled
– 1/2 onion, diced
– 1 bell pepper, diced
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– Spices: turmeric, garlic powder, salt, and pepper
Instructions:
1.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at.
2. Sauté onions and bell pepper until soft.
3. Add crumbled tofu and spices, cooking until heated through.
4. Serve with toast or in a wrap.
– Feel free to add your favorite vegetables like spinach or tomatoes!
– This scramble is excellent for meal prep and stores well in the fridge!

18. Maple Almond Granola

Ready for a crunchy breakfast option you can prepare in advance? This maple almond granola is wholesome, delicious, and perfect for snacking too!Made with oats, almonds, and a touch of maple syrup, this granola is sweet, crunchy, and gluten-free. Serve it with almond milk or yogurt for a delightful breakfast that feels indulgent!
Ingredients:
– 2 cups rolled oats
– 1 cup almonds, chopped
– 1/4 cup maple syrup
– 1/4 cup coconut oil, melted
– 1/2 teaspoon salt
Instructions:
1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
2. In a bowl, mix oats, almonds, maple syrup, melted coconut oil, and salt.
3. Spread on a baking sheet and bake for 20-25 minutes, stirring halfway through.
4. Cool completely before storing in an airtight container.
– Add dried fruits after baking for extra sweetness!
– Perfect for topping smoothie bowls or yogurt!
